Franck Muller Crazy Hours Ref. 7851 Case size 35 x 43mm , it depends on the measurement. The watch reference comes in various material and dial variations. Self-winding movement cal. FM 2800-CHR. Franck Muller often hailed as the “Master of Complications,” built his reputation by redefining how we read time, and nowhere is that spirit bolder than in the Crazy Hours. This whimsical creation scatters its numerals in delightful disorder, while the ingenious movement leaps faithfully from hour to hour, turning chaos into precision.

In 1991, Franck called on Vartan to design his new cases. The two men quickly realized that their complementary skills could enable them to create an extraordinary brand—without imagining that decades years later it would become one of the most renowned names in the world of watchmaking. Their watch collection includes the Long Island, Crazy Hours, Curvex, Round, Skafander and Vanguard. Officially founded in 1991 in the village of Genthod near Geneva, the Franck Muller Manufacture moved three years later, still in Genthod, to a castle dating from 1905. This peaceful 16-hectare site overlooking Lake Geneva and Mont Blanc became more than just a production site; it was a concept called Watchland. In less than 20 years, the watch brand has built a global reputation characterized by spectacular growth, enviable financial strength, and production of 40,000 watches per year.
